The cheapest way to get from Bamburgh to Hawick is to drive which costs £12 - £19 and takes 1h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Bamburgh to Hawick is to drive which takes 1h 7m and costs £12 - £19.
No, there is no direct bus from Bamburgh to Hawick. However, there are services departing from The Grove and arriving at Mart Street Bus Stance via Berwick station and Galashiels Transport Interchange.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 17m.
The distance between Bamburgh and Hawick is 127 miles. The road distance is 52.9 miles.
The best way to get from Bamburgh to Hawick without a car is to bus and train which takes 3h 56m and costs £30 - £120.
It takes approximately 3h 56m to get from Bamburgh to Hawick, including transfers.
